Autologon ignoring part of a password. |
Two Question on the Autologon
Q !: Does Zmud 721 Ignore certain keys when, that key stroke char, is use in a password
My password is not working and checking through Zmud, found that one key stroke char, is missing.
Q 2 How do you enable the autologon feature, so Zmud run through its' Auto detect process again. |

What is the char that doesn't go through?
The zMUD auto-logon feature is really a simple trigger, there's no to reset it.
You can use #CHARACTER and #PW to resend the info. |

The character that wasn't going through was the = sign . I login though another client and then changed the password to remove it. My other Character had no problems ( run three at once) for they had no = sign in their passwords.
Zmud would ask for the password and wait and wait and then disconnect, when tying to login using a password with that sign (=).

sounds like a parsing issue, it thinks you are defining a variable...
try clicking on the little computer icon beside the command line to turn parsing off. |
